Output acafb0264889c602b2db39ce5e71b1381621c34979f96924f69c394d56404772:1

value
7762758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b406bdadaa62df51da51ccb1cf561abf68bff6 OP_EQUAL
address
32DAxx9rYhTpmTHHsqCCorrn6GDVR8PyqM
transaction
acafb0264889c602b2db39ce5e71b1381621c34979f96924f69c394d56404772
confirmations
308261
spent
true